The Lowdown
Alright, Rusty again. Let's break it down in feet and miles.
So, look, I’m not gonna sugarcoat it—this is a rough stretch for Herzliya. The whole 16-day window is a quiet one, with barely a ripple to get excited about. There’s a big gap of nothing, and the only break that pops up is Haambatia (Herzliya). The swell is tiny, the period is short, and the wind is mostly a pain. The water temperature starts at 84°F, which is a touch warmer than usual for this time of year, so at least it’s a warm bath.
The first real chance comes on Thursday, July 30th, in the morning. You’ve got a weak 3ft swell from the WNW, with a period of 7 seconds. The combined energy is only 62, which is weak. The wind is a light cross-onshore from the WSW, so it’s not totally trashed, but it’s not clean. It’s a “marginal” call, and I’d say that’s about right. Then on Thursday, August 6th, in the morning, we get a similar setup: 3ft from the WNW, 7-second period, energy at 60. Again, light cross-onshore wind from the WSW. Still marginal. That’s the best you’re getting.
The rest of the days are a write-off. Swell is often under 2ft, with periods dropping to 3–4 seconds, and cross-onshore winds chopping it up. There are a few glassy mornings on August 1st, 7th, 8th, 9th, 10th, and 11th, but the swell is just too small and weak. You’d be floating.
If you’re desperate, the mornings of July 30th and August 6th are your only real options. For a beginner, this is a week to stay on the beach. The combined swell energy is weak, and the swell direction from the WNW isn’t the right angle for this spot, which is open to the W. This kind of quiet run is normal for the summer here, so don’t lose hope. Forecasts can change, but right now, it’s flat.

Our Haambatia (Herzliya) sur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Haambatia (Herzliya))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
